Output 8cd57c8ee70809d04d292ee19b0989d77f705119e232c645e4b20cac7b59020e:4

value
569873420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2ddaabc04f1e859a68f91947c9e364cb7f3e018c8ca25785c1d17fc973c6232
address
tb1putw640qy7859nf50jx28e83kfjml8cqcer9z27zur5tle9euvgeq9ffu5v
transaction
8cd57c8ee70809d04d292ee19b0989d77f705119e232c645e4b20cac7b59020e